Can Legionella be eliminated once and for all from domestic hot-water circuits? Yes it can!

Summary
The paper presents a solution enabling prevention of the growth of Legionella in hot water loops. The solution is based on control of temperatures in all parts of the circuit, which must remain above a certain level. The key benefit of this solution is that it operates continuously; on the contrary, cleaning, or use of an antiseptic exert only transient effects.
